  • Body camera footage from March 10 shows the moments Akron police officers found three bodies that were bound, gagged and shot in the head. Detectives later spoke to neighbors in hopes of finding clues as to what happened and how the three men were killed. “It’s upsetting,” one neighbor was captured saying in the footage. “It’s gross.” Investigators were able to track down the suspected killer - 58-year-old Elias Gudino - and charged him with aggravated murder and attempted aggravated murder. Police say more charges and arrests could be coming soon.
